What Lily’s Dress on The Young and the Restless Today Means for Her Character

On The Young and the Restless today, Lily’s dress serves as a concise visual summary of her current arc, signaling emotional shifts and relationship dynamics through color, silhouette, and styling details.

Why the Dress Matters in Storytelling

Costume choices on serial television communicate status changes and turning points efficiently. For Lily, the selected dress today aligns with narrative beats such as family negotiations and personal reconciliations, using design details to show composure and underlying tension.

Character Context for Lily’s Current Arc

Lily has navigated marriage, motherhood, and entrepreneurial challenges on-screen. Today’s styling reflects a more mature, controlled version of her earlier bolder looks, mirroring stabilized relationships and renewed focus on long-term goals.

Behind the Scenes: Wardrobe Process

The daytime wardrobe team aligns outfits with script notes and character milestones. For scenes involving high-stakes conversations, they often opt for structured pieces that convey control, as seen in Lily’s dress on today’s episode.

Factors Guiding Wardrobe Decisions

  • Scene location and time of day
  • Emotional arc for the character
  • Consistency with established wardrobe DNA

Audience Interpretation and Symbolism

Viewers often attach personal symbolism to clothing on long-running shows. While the writers do not confirm individual outfit meanings, recurring motifs in Lily’s attire—such as clean lines and deliberate color accents—correspond with her journey toward renewed confidence and measured risk-taking.
